It's good that you went to the side, but often it was the wrong side. Always move away from your opponent's power side, usually in the back. (right in my case) Another big issue with the footwork is you were crossing your feet like crazy. You would do okay when you would rush in to use your hands, but almost every other time they were crossing.
Additionally, you seemed to use either punches or kicks, you never mixed it up, which of course makes your strikes much easier to defend against. Don't be afraid to go to the body with your hands. Often flurries where you mix up high and low work especially good against larger opponents who have more area to cover up.
Another thing you want to think about is range, sometimes you were just chilling in my range and outside of your range. Thats where you never want to be. You want to minimize the time spent in that area. I can tell you understood this concept, and two minutes isn't really enough time to acclimate yourself, but it's something to keep in mind.
